Sheikhupur Bagh

Sheikhupur Bagh is a village located in Nawanshahr tehsil of Shahid Bhagat Singh Nagar district in Punjab,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Nawanshahr (tehsildar office) and 15km away from district headquarter Shahid Bhagat Singh Nagar . As per 2009 stats, Shekhupur Bag is the gram panchayat of Sheikhupur Bagh village.

About Sheikhupur Bagh

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sheikhupur Bagh is 032331. The village spans a total geographical area of 219 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 144515. Nawansahar is nearest town to Sheikhupur Bagh village for all major economic activities.

Population of Sheikhupur Bagh

According to the 2011 Census, Sheikhupur Bagh has a total population of about 924, with approximately 474 males and 450 females. The sex ratio is around 949 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 89 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 309 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 71.65%, with male literacy at about 78.27% and female literacy near 64.67%. There are around 181 households in the village. Connectivity of Sheikhupur Bagh

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sheikhupur Bagh. As per the 2011 stats, Sheikhupur Bagh had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
